Subject: DR Drill — Session-Token Refresh Bug

Team, during tomorrow's disaster-recovery drill for Fernvale Desk, expect the known token-refresh bug: restored sessions may expire immediately after failover. Advise affected users to sign in again rather than retrying. If the support console itself loses its session, restore access with the recovery passphrase below.

vault phrase of tajef-tafog = istox-sorax-zorox-casok-holox-kelix-weneth-drueth-casion

## Meet Gaugelet, our metrics sidecar

Every service pod at Quillhaven ships with Gaugelet, a little sidecar that scrapes local metrics and batches them up to the Tallyhouse aggregator every 15 seconds. If dashboards go flat during your on-call shift, it's usually Gaugelet that fell over, not the service itself. Restart it with the `gaugelet-kick` script. The sidecar authenticates to Tallyhouse's internal ingest API using the key below.

service key, fawip-bajef: kto11_Qt5wZK9vdNC

## Step 4: Enable shard routing

The Fernhollow profile store now splits users across four shards keyed by account hash. Dual-write mode must be on before you flip reads, or you will serve stale profiles. Run the backfill job first; it is idempotent and safe to retry. Verify shard counts with the `fh-audit` tool before proceeding to Step 5. Do not skip the audit — rebalancing after a bad cut is painful. Set the router's configuration to the following values.

settings of tagef-bawif:
DRUIX_HOST=druix.zemvarlabs.internal
DRUIX_PORT=8000

## Formula sandbox tuning

User-supplied formulas in Gridmoor execute inside a restricted interpreter with hard ceilings on time, memory, and call depth. Reviewers should confirm any change to these ceilings is justified in the PR description, since raising them widens the abuse surface. Defaults were chosen from production traces. The current limits are as follows.

limits module of tafog-fawip:
WEIGHTS = {
    "julix": 57,
    "lamys": 992,
    "kasvan": 209,
    "quenok": 750,
    "alddor": 259,
    "oliath": 1009,
    "wenix": 815,
}